§ 33-3-11 — Discretionary refusal, revocation or suspension; penalty in lieu thereof; reissuance
(a)The commissioner may after notice and hearing refuse to renew, or may revoke or suspend the license of an insurer, in addition to other grounds therefor in this chapter, if the insurer:
(1)Violates any provision of this chapter other than those as to which refusal, suspension or revocation is mandatory;
(2)Fails to comply with any lawful rule, regulation or order of the commissioner;
(3)Is transacting insurance in an illegal, improper or unjust manner;
(4)Is found by the commissioner to be in an unsound condition or in such condition as to render its further transaction of insurance in West Virginia hazardous to its policyholders or to the people of West Virginia;
